A full-service commercial bank in Saudi Arabia with regional offices and a wide retail branch network needed to replace a fragmented call-recording setup—two separate systems plus physical recorders at branches—that drove up operational and maintenance costs, increased IT complexity, and risked non-compliance with local AML and record-keeping regulations requiring long-term capture of transaction-related communications.
The bank deployed Verint Financial Compliance as a centralized, WAN-enabled recording platform integrated with Cisco, eliminating branch servers, consolidating legacy systems, and adding strong encryption, role-based access and automated recording assurance. The solution now captures over 7,300 interactions per day, meets Saudi AML requirements, scales to nearly 500 recorded users, reduces hardware and maintenance costs, and improves IT productivity and compliance responsiveness.
